Endless Summer Sweets is a dessert restaurant in Berkeley, California, serving fair- and carnival-inspired treats and snacks at 2358 Shattuck Ave., Berkeley, CA 94704. For anyone looking for dessert near Shattuck Avenue, this is a casual spot centered on familiar, playful food rather than a traditional pastry-only experience. The menu described by guests makes it a fitting choice for an after-dinner sweet, a quick neighborhood snack, or a relaxed stop before heading home.
Funnel cakes are a standout part of the experience at Endless Summer Sweets. Customers have specifically mentioned the original funnel cake topped with ice cream, as well as a strawberry funnel cake and churros. Reviews also point to fried Oreos, caramel apples, ice cream, and soft serve as part of the fun, fair-style selection. These are the kinds of nostalgic treats that can turn a simple dessert run into a moment worth sharing with friends, family, or a partner.
The offerings are not limited to sweets. Guests have also noted corn dogs, garlic fries, and a chicken sandwich with grilled onions on Hawaiian rolls, giving visitors savory options alongside dessert. That mix can be especially convenient for groups when not everyone wants the same kind of snack. One customer described enjoying their food right away in the car, while another appreciated the friendly service and sweets. The overall impression from many reviews is of a place that leans into comforting, childhood-inspired carnival flavors.
With a 4.6 rating from 666 reviews, Endless Summer Sweets has drawn substantial local feedback from Berkeley diners. It is open daily from 12:00 PM to 10:00 PM, making it an accessible option for afternoon cravings, evening dessert, or a late snack. Experiences can vary, and one review raised concerns about an incorrect order and allergy-related handling. Guests with allergies or specific dietary needs may want to confirm ingredients and their order directly with the team before eating. For a Berkeley dessert restaurant with funnel cakes, ice cream, churros, and savory fair-food favorites, Endless Summer Sweets offers a casual, flavorful stop on Shattuck Avenue.

Friendly service with wonderful sweets. Quite enjoy their original funnel cake with ice cream on top.
Would need another visit here but I can really see the potential! The theme is fair/faire/carnival foods and they have so much fun stuff, including fried oreos, corn dogs, funnel cakes and ice cream! We only stopped in for (what I hoped would be) a quick snack of an ice cream cone and a caramel apple. Unfortunately despite only one other party being in the shop, I think they maybe had a large order because it took the staff a long time to get to us - you place your own order at the kiosk - and only the ice cream had to be scooped. Anyway, both things passed muster and were thoroughly enjoyed. At $16 plus tip for 2 items it's steep, but it was a treat and we were trying it out. I can totally see this place being a great choice for a catered/themed party and lots of fun things for kids to eat, especially since we never have carnivals around here and it's rarely actually summer! Hope to pop back in for a funnel cake and a milkshake some other time.
I finally came here after months of my niece telling me to visit, and I wasn't disappointed. I order garlic fries, with a chicken sandwich and a small soft serve with chocolate. The chicken sandwich was outstanding, which came with grilled onion on Hawaiian rolls. The garlic fries were good, but they needed a little salt, and the ice cream was amazing along with the whipped cream.... the whipped cream is the best whipped cream I've ever had. My niece also got a small apple funnel cake. If you're in the area, this is a must visit.
